Environmentally Conscious Materials Selection

With the increasing demand for groundbreaking architectural concepts, the adoption of environmentally responsible materials has become critical in lowering the overall environmental footprint. Architects are placing greater emphasis on materials that are renewable, recyclable, and locally sourced. This strategy not only reduces the transportation-related carbon footprint but also strengthens local economic growth. Materials such as bamboo, salvaged timber, and recycled metals are rising in demand for their durability and aesthetic appeal. In addition, the application of low-VOC coatings and finishes supports improved indoor air quality. By integrating sustainable materials into their designs, architects can develop areas that are simultaneously practical and inspiring but also mindful of the environment, fostering a culture of sustainability in the built environment.

Sustainable Design Techniques

The combination of sustainable materials effectively enhances sustainable design methods in building design. These practices focus on lowering energy demands while promoting a more comfortable environment for occupants. Designers often emphasize passive solar strategies, maximizing natural light and ventilation to minimize reliance on artificial systems. The careful arrangement of windows, shading features, and thermal mass can significantly reduce the need for heating and cooling. Moreover, utilizing advanced insulation and efficient HVAC technology guarantees that buildings maintain ideal temperatures with minimal energy expenditure. Harnessing renewable energy solutions, including solar panels, further strengthens a building's environmental performance. Ultimately, energy-efficient design practices not only reduce environmental impact but also encourage lasting financial take the first step benefits, aligning with the growing demand for responsible and forward-thinking architectural solutions.

Green Building Certifications

As the demand for sustainable architecture increases, green building certifications have established themselves as key benchmarks for measuring environmental impact. Certifications such as LEED, BREEAM, and the Living Building Challenge offer comprehensive frameworks for evaluating energy efficiency, water conservation, and materials sustainability. They encourage architects to adopt innovative design practices that minimize environmental impact while enhancing occupant well-being. By meeting stringent criteria, projects not only achieve recognition but also gain a competitive edge in the market. Furthermore, green certifications often lead to long-term cost savings through reduced energy consumption and operational efficiency. At their core, these certifications function as a directing framework for architects seeking to develop spaces that are both efficient and environmentally responsible, supporting a more sustainable future in the built environment.

How to Make Your Architectural Ideas Come to Life

Transforming architectural ideas into tangible structures demands a structured methodology that combines imaginative thinking with technical knowledge. The opening stage focuses on extensive research and ideation, as architects collect ideas from multiple sources, such as nature, cultural influences, and technological advancements. This phase often includes sketches and digital models to visualize the concepts.

Subsequently, collaboration with stakeholders, engineers, and contractors is vital to ensure feasibility and refine ideas. Producing thorough blueprints and technical specifications enables precise execution during construction. Architects are also required to navigate zoning laws and building codes, guaranteeing conformity with applicable regulations.

During the entire process, strong communication is key. Frequent updates and collaborative feedback with everyone involved encourage cohesion and tackle potential concerns before they escalate. Finally, the construction phase brings the vision to life, requiring ongoing oversight to maintain design integrity. Through the combination of creativity and structured approaches, architects are able to effectively convert their innovative concepts into functional and inspiring environments.

Latest Trends in Architectural Design Services

New developments in innovation and sustainability are redefining the future of architecture and design. Design professionals are embedding intelligent systems into their designs, employing data-driven analytics and automation to improve performance and efficiency. BIM technology has emerged as an industry standard, enabling precise visualization and collaboration throughout the entire project cycle.

Green design methodologies are steadily rising in importance, with building professionals concentrating on low-energy materials and clean energy alternatives. The growing trend of biophilic design highlights the relationship between the natural world and constructed spaces, supporting overall wellness and increased performance.

Moreover, adaptable and versatile spaces are increasingly sought after, addressing shifting requirements and contemporary ways of living. The rise of remote work has influenced residential and commercial designs, leading to multifunctional spaces that prioritize both comfort and utility. Collectively, these developments demonstrate a dedication to innovation, sustainability, and human-centered design within modern architectural practice.

What Are the Standard Project Delivery Methods in Architecture?

Widely used methods for delivering projects in the field of architecture include Design-Bid-Build, Design-Build, Construction Management at Risk, and Integrated Project Delivery. Each of these methods presents distinct advantages, impacting costs, timelines, and stakeholder collaboration across the entire project lifecycle.
